### Runbook: BounceBroom — Account Recovery

If the BounceBroom email bounce processor loses access to its service account, do not create a new one. First, pause the intake queue so bounces buffer safely. Then open the recovery console and select the BounceBroom principal. Verification requires approval from the on-call lead. Once approved, the console prompts for the stored recovery credentials; enter the passphrase that appears directly below this paragraph.

recovery phrase for fahof-kahap: holion-gormir-jorix-istix-briwyn-sorael

### Step 4: Migrate the order-cutoff rule

Crumbline's legacy cutoff logic for the Dellhaven bakery lived in application code; version 3 moves it into the rules engine so changes are auditable. During migration, both paths run in shadow mode and discrepancies are logged for review. Verify that the cutoff evaluation events carry the new rule identifier before disabling the legacy path. Once shadow mode confirms parity, apply the configuration below to the rules engine.

deployment values, bagaf-yahip:
LAMYS_PIN=0054
LAMYS_TENANT=wenax
LAMYS_METRICS_HOST=metrics.lamys.tolvaqhq.internal
LAMYS_SEAL=seal_e459e220
LAMYS_STANDBY_TEAM=rusath

Subject: Proposed "Meridian" Subscription Tier — Financial Review

Executive team,

Attached is the pricing model for the Meridian tier of our Quillbase platform. Margin assumptions rest on a 7% conversion from the Standard plan and modest support overhead. Finance asks that revenue recognition treatment be confirmed before launch sign-off. Kindly review the sensitivity tables by Thursday. The confidential strategic framing appears directly below.

internal memo for bahap-yagug: Headcount on the Ulaix team goes from 3 to 100 by the end of January. Gross margin on Ulaix came in at 10 percent against a plan of 15 percent.